site.btaOver 100 Cars and Trucks Stranded at Border between Bulgaria and Republic of North Macedonia


More than 100 cars and dozens of heavy-duty trucks are stranded at the border between Bulgaria and the Republic of North Macedonia between the checkpoints of Gyueshevo and Deve Bair. Some of them are on their way to Skopje to pay tribute to revolutionary Gotse Delchev on the occasion of his 151st birth anniversary.
Gotse Delchev’s grave at the Skopje Church of the Ascension [Sveti Spas] is a traditional place of veneration on this day. The revolutionary is celebrated as a national hero both by Bulgaria and the Republic of North Macedonia.
Traffic was suspended around 9:00 on Saturday morning. Checkpoint officials explained that it was because of a glitch in the technical system which they expected to be fixed after noon.
Some of those in the stranded vehicles described the situation as a provocation. The chairman of the Macedonia Foundation, Viktor Stoyanov, said Bulgaria needed to respond to these actions appropriately.
Among the waiting cars are also some with number plates from Serbia and North Macedonia.
